MASSACHUSETTS — Police in Danvers said a 22-year-old man accidentally drove his car off a bridge and into a river on Monday night because he was distracted by a text message.

Gerald Maher clipped a snowbank with his 1999 Nissan Altima first, and then crashed through the guardrail on the opposite side of the road. His car landed in the river, but he was able to climb out and swim to shore. He was transported to the hospital for an evaluation and then released.
Maher wasn’t arrested, but he was charged with negligent operation of a vehicle and texting while driving. It’s also possible that he will have to pay to repair the guardrail, which was torn completely off.
